So yesterday I was applying duac gel to my face and it caused my skin to flake and then a few minutes later it began to hurt like mad so I look at it and my skin is all broken and ripped in that area. I don’t know what to do. It’s all red and raw, how long will this take to heal??

I'd pop into a pharmacy for advice. They can look at it, suggest some things that might relieve it a bit, give you an idea of how long it's likely to last and help you work out why it happened and how to avoid it in the future.
